How they compare

Brazil currently reports 24.0% against 23.9% in Kenya, a difference of 0.1%.

Across all 11 years both countries report, Brazil has been ahead every year.

Brazil ranks 24th and Kenya ranks 25th of 144 countries.

Brazil has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Brazil Kenya Difference Ahead
1960s 15.7% 3.1% 12.7% Brazil
1970s 11.9% 2.5% 9.4% Brazil
1980s 11.3% 2.7% 8.6% Brazil
1990s 27.3% 7.7% 19.7% Brazil
2000s 28.7% 18.6% 10.1% Brazil
2010s 24.0% 23.9% 0.2% Brazil

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
